Founder and CEO
Babitha Jampala has a PhD in Plant Breeding from Texas A&M. She has extensive experience with field research and molecular breeding techniques. Her current work on Hemp fiber quality lines is focused on variety evaluation, crop rotation, environmental impacts, and circular economy solutions
VP, Operations
Naveen Adusumilli has a PhD in Agricultural Economics. He is an extension specialist and has served in several policy committees, including Gov. John Bel Edwards Climate Task Force Agricultural Subcommittee. His research led to more than $ 4 million in grant activities. His specialization in monetizing carbon sequestration strategies within working lands has led to both national and international collaborations.
Sana Genetics is driving solutions in Hemp genetics with data-driven economic and sustainable options for crop rotation, soil health, and circular economy.
Evaluating the economic and environmental suitability of the crop in humid mid-south and other geographic regions.
with field and lab research, we provide data-driven solutions.
The staff provides consultation to interested groups to adopt Hemp into their sustainable alternatives within farming enterprises and industrial solutions.
We also consult on strategies to monetize carbon credits within working lands.
We provide in-depth guidance on solutions with an emphasis on economic and environmental approaches to sustainably grow hemp, carbon sequestration strategies, and federal conservation incentives. Consultations will be charged at an hourly rate.
